What are hormones: - ANSWER>>>>>they are compounds that are
secreted into the bloodstream by different cells, and their goal is to act
to control the function of another type of cell
Ghrelin: - ANSWER>>>>>is produced by the stomach; its job is to travel
to the brain,stimulate the hunger center, and deactivate the satiety
center
Leptin: - ANSWER>>>>>is produced by fat cells called adipose tissue; its
job is to alert the brain, turn off the hunger center, and activate the
satiety center' any time your eating your leptin levels should increase to
tell you that your full
